The phrase "advanced breeding programs"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to agriculture, animal husbandry, or genetics, where sophisticated techniques are employed to enhance breeding outcomes.
Example: "The research facility is known for its advanced breeding programs that aim to produce disease-resistant crop varieties."
Alternatives: "sophisticated breeding initiatives" or "enhanced breeding schemes".
